An exceptional answer

Yes, I have encountered a hazardous situation during a waste collection route that required immediate attention. While collecting waste in a busy commercial area, I came across a leaking chemical drum that emitted a pungent odor and posed a potential environmental and public health risk. Understanding the urgency of the situation, I quickly contacted the local environmental agency and reported the incident, providing them with accurate details about the location and the nature of the leakage. Simultaneously, I cordoned off the area using caution tapes and traffic cones to ensure the safety of pedestrians and prevent further exposure. I also used my communication skills to inform nearby business owners about the situation and advised them on how to manage their operations safely until the issue was resolved. Additionally, I documented the incident and maintained regular communication with the environmental agency until the cleanup process was complete. Through my prompt action and effective communication, the hazardous situation was successfully managed, minimizing any potential harm to both the environment and the community.

How to prepare for this question

  • Familiarize yourself with local waste disposal regulations and safety procedures to effectively handle hazardous situations.
  • Develop strong communication and customer service skills to interact with stakeholders and address concerns promptly.
  • Enhance problem-solving skills to propose practical solutions in challenging situations.
  • Practice prioritizing tasks and managing time efficiently to maintain collection schedules.
  • Stay updated on the latest waste management practices and technologies to improve collection route efficiencies.
